Your first link is almost 20 years old, pretty bad for anything science related. Your second link is a blog that cites the third link for a portion of its argument. The third link is attacking a scientific study that is over 20 years old again. Also the framing of the argument is not quite right, as is often the case with the heartland. They state the study does not make a hard case for correlation then go with a fallacy called 'negative proof fallacy'. They are saying since the EPA report did not prove what they wanted then the opposite is true. Nope, to prove the opposite is true you have to prove that it is true. If someone is attacking old science when new science is available that should be a red flag that their argument may be weak. Here is some non blogs that have some RECENT information.
